### Runbook: BounceBroom — Account Recovery

If the BounceBroom email bounce processor loses access to its service account, do not create a new one. First, pause the intake queue so bounces buffer safely. Then open the recovery console and select the BounceBroom principal. Verification requires approval from the on-call lead. Once approved, the console prompts for the stored recovery credentials; enter the passphrase that appears directly below this paragraph.

recovery phrase for fahof-kahap: holion-gormir-jorix-istix-briwyn-sorael

## Partner SFTP Drop — Marlowe Freight

Files land nightly between 02:00–03:30 UTC in the inbound drop. Watcher job `marlowe-ingest` picks them up; if nothing arrives by 04:00, the Quillhook alert fires. Do NOT re-request files from Marlowe before checking the quarantine folder — malformed headers get parked there silently. Retries are safe; ingest is idempotent on file checksum. Rotation of the drop credentials is quarterly, owned by platform. Full escalation steps and contacts are on the runbook page.

dashboard of taduf-tahof = https://confluence.tolvaqlabs.internal/browse/browse/display/f01240ca

For branch managers ahead of the leadership review: the Bramleigh reseller programme now covers 19 partners across the Norcott and Aldermere regions, contributing roughly a fifth of channel revenue. Partner training completion sits at 84%, and returns rates have fallen steadily since the revised onboarding checklist was introduced. We are proposing a tiered discount structure and stricter territory boundaries for next year. Please review the figures carefully; the commercial reasoning is laid out in the confidential note below.

board note of kageg-bahof: The renewal with Holwynax Holdings closes at $2 million a year, 5 percent below the last contract. Project Ulaath slips by two quarters because of the supplier delay.